What companies run services between Portugal and Hungary?

Ryanair and easyJet fly from Francisco De Sá Carneiro Airport (OPO) to Budapest Ferenc Liszt International Airport (BUD) once daily. Alternatively, you can take a bus from Martim Moniz to Clark Ádám tér via Estação Oriente, Lisbon, Zurich Bus Station, Budapest, Népliget Autóbusz-Pályaudvar, and Deák Ferenc tér M in around 2d.
